About S. Geetha

S. Geetha is a scholar working on Computer Vision and Pattern Recognition, Signal Processing, Artificial Intelligence, Information Systems and Computer Networks and Communications, having authored 171 papers that have together received 2.2k indexed citations. Recurring topics across this work include Advanced Steganography and Watermarking Techniques (48 papers), Digital Media Forensic Detection (40 papers), Chaos-based Image/Signal Encryption (28 papers), Network Security and Intrusion Detection (23 papers), Advanced Malware Detection Techniques (21 papers), Biometric Identification and Security (11 papers), Anomaly Detection Techniques and Applications (10 papers) and User Authentication and Security Systems (10 papers). The work is most often cited by research in Signal Processing (632 citations), Computer Networks and Communications (723 citations), Health Information Management (123 citations), Computer Vision and Pattern Recognition (564 citations) and Artificial Intelligence (896 citations). S. Geetha has collaborated with scholars based in India, United States and United Arab Emirates. Frequent co-authors include Siva S. Sivatha Sindhu, A. Kannan, S. Abijah Roseline, Seifedine Kadry, Robertas Damaševičius, N. Kamaraj, S. Sasikala, S. Balamurugan, K. P. K. Nair and Yunyoung Nam. Their work appears in journals such as Multimedia Tools and Applications, IEEE Access, Journal of the Operational Research Society, European Journal of Operational Research and Scientific Reports.
